Description

Black Austin Matters is a podcast that highlights the Black community and Black culture in Central Texas. Each month, hosts Dr. Richard J. Reddick and Dr. Lisa B. Thompson talk with other Black Austinites about their perspectives on what’s happening in their city. We’ll hear from the well-known and the not-so-well-known in Austin’s Black community to find out what matters to them. New episodes the first Wednesday of the month.
